I have lived in cities all my life before moving to the James O Fraser Centre. I wasn't much of a gardner or farmer or handyman. Here we raise pigs, chickens, ducks, rabbits, farm rice and corn. It's been a steep learning curve but a good one. I've learnt so much. My latest project is a strawberry patch. Back in Australia I couldn't even keep any of the strawberry plants I bought alive. Here after learning about soil, watering, sun and fertiliser, strawberry runners, I've taken 1 strawberry pot and grown it to 3 patches of strawberries with about 20 strawberry plants. The first fruits have just come out. Who would have guessed all this from a "city boy". There are so many new skills I've learnt since coming to Thailand.
